This year has gone very hard with us; ye Rains have been
excessive & ye Heats excessive wh have caused a great many
Diseases, & to us a great many Rides. Our Hands, are few,
weak & in great Decay. Our Rides are often twice a Day, yet
I’ve often in a Week rid between 50 & 60 Miles a Day, it’s true
our Horses in this Country go so easy that a Ride of 50
Mile, perhaps won’t tire a Mare so much as 20 or 30 with
yr Horses in England, yet they are so frequent that it is
enough to break ye strongest Constitution. I can’t say
but I wish you had one of our Horses to ride for yr own
convenience, they are handy & will go easey ye whole Day.
they make nothing of traveling 60 miles in a day, wh few
Horses in England can perform, for any while. All that is kind t
